A
Andrew Harte Review of iBuddy Ltd
💯 iBuddy Ltd is absolutely fantastic! I have been ...
💯 iBuddy Ltd is absolutely fantastic! I have been a loyal customer for years and I couldn't be happier with their products. The customer service is excellent and the quality of their products is unmatched. Highly recommended!

Comments: